    Summer, Sun, Swimming Fun: Prague’s Swimming Pools for Hot Days

    Summer in the city means long, sunny days and warm nights. What helps? Obviously, cooling off in refreshing water!

    The sun is blazing, the asphalt is shimmering – summer in the city can be quite exhausting. Fortunately, there are plenty of places in Prague where you can cool down.

    Summer is just around the corner, and we all know what summer in the city feels like – long, sunny days, warm nights and… for many city dwellers, the warm season can be a real challenge on some days.

    But what can you do to stay active in the city during summer – without locking yourself away in air-conditioned gyms? Of course, you could try getting up early or spending the evenings in one of Prague’s many parks. But there is an even better solution: swimming!

    There are numerous swimming pools in Prague – both indoor and outdoor. Here is an overview of where you can cool off on hot summer days.
